Overview

Welcome to the controls team! Building the car is only half the battle. The drivers perform the other half at the competition. In order to compete the driver must be aware of and control several systems on the car. We design the pedals, steering, and cockpit to bring the most out of the drivers and car while still remaining safe. In addition to the traditional engineering design process our team members will be exposed to several race engineering topics. Pedals & Brakes

This team focuses on being able to control the acceleration of the car. Whether your putting the pedal to the metal or slamming on the brakes we'll make sure its both an enjoyable and safe ride. Through this team you will learn vehicle dynamics, heat transfer, and basic automotive maintenance.

Driver Ergonomics

This team focuses on ensuring the driver is comfortable, aware, and can control the direction of the car. From determining the seat position to the information on the display to designing the steering system we ensure the driver has complete control. Through this team you will learn a variety of skills ranging from vehicle dynamics and composite manufacturing to basic kinesthetics and more.
